Anas Zniti (born 28 October 1988) is a Moroccan footballer who plays as a goalkeeper for FAR Rabat. He previously played for Maghreb Fez.[1]

In March 2006, Zniti was called up for a training camp of the Morocco Olympic squad,[2] remaining in the squad the following year for further Olympic qualifying games.[3]
